Breaking Down the Landscape of Sports Betting Ontario

The world of sports betting in Ontario has undergone significant change since the legalization and regulation of single-event wagering in 2021. What was once a fragmented and confusing scene has evolved into a more organized, accessible market. But even with these improvements, newcomers and seasoned bettors alike might find themselves overwhelmed by the sheer number of options and platforms available.

What makes the difference now is the growing focus on user-friendly experiences and transparency. Whether you prefer betting on hockey, basketball, or even niche sports, Ontario’s regulated environment ensures that reputable providers adhere to strict standards. This means fair play, secure transactions, and accountability under the Alcohol and Gaming Commission of Ontario (AGCO).

Key Players and Technologies Shaping the Market

Ontario’s market is now home to a range of operators, including long-established sportsbooks like Bet365 and PointsBet, alongside newer entrants such as DraftKings and FanDuel. These platforms leverage advanced technology to deliver smooth, real-time betting experiences. The use of SSL encryption and secure payment methods like Interac e-Transfer and credit card options are standard, ensuring financial safety for users.

Live betting has become increasingly popular, supported by robust streaming capabilities and instant odds updates. Behind the scenes, game providers and software developers continuously innovate to keep the experience engaging and fair. For example, integrating AI-driven analytics enables better odds-making and risk management, which benefits both the operators and the bettors.

Practical Tips for Navigating Ontario’s Sportsbooks Effectively

When stepping into the realm of sports wagering here, a clear strategy can save time and money. First, understand the regulatory framework to avoid unauthorized sites that may expose you to unnecessary risks. Always verify if a sportsbook holds an AGCO license – a reliable sign of legitimacy.

Second, take advantage of promotions but read the fine print carefully. Wagering requirements and withdrawal limits can turn seemingly generous offers into costly mistakes. Third, diversify your bets and set realistic limits, especially if you’re new to betting. Managing your bankroll responsibly is crucial to enjoying the experience without undue stress.

Here’s a quick checklist to keep in mind:

  • Confirm sportsbook licensing and compliance
  • Choose secure payment methods like Interac and major credit cards
  • Understand the terms behind bonuses and promotions
  • Set personal betting limits to avoid overexposure
  • Stay informed about the latest odds and market trends

The Role of Responsible Betting and Awareness

It’s easy to get caught up in the excitement of placing a wager, but understanding your limits is essential. The Ontario gaming authority encourages bettors to approach sports betting as a form of entertainment, not a guaranteed income source. Tools such as deposit limits, self-exclusion programs, and time-outs are available on most licensed platforms to support responsible gambling.
